   [11,584] In the Matter of Bank of Hollandale, Hollandale Mississippi, Docket No. FDIC-98-084q (12-30-98)

   FDIC terminates insured status of bank where another bank has assumed the liabilities for its deposits.
In the Matter of

BANK OF HOLLANDALE
HOLLANDALE, MISSISSIPPI
(Insured State Nonmember Bank)
ORDER OF APPROVAL
OF TERMINATION of
INSURANCE

FDIC-98-084q

   Pursuant to section 8(q) of the Federal Deposit Insurance Act ("Act"), 12 U.S.C. §1818(q), and section 18(i)(3) of the Act, 12 U.S.C. §1828(i)(3), the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ation ("FDIC"), having found that Guaranty Bank and Trust Company, Belzoni, Mississippi ("Guaranty"), has provided to the FDIC on August 13, 1998, satisfactory evidence that it has assumed the liabilities for deposits of Bank of Hollandale, Hollandale, Mississippi ("Hollandale"), as of August 7, 1998, as required by section 307.1 of the FDIC's hereby issues the following ORDER:

ORDER

   IT IS HEREBY ORDERED, that the status of Hollandale as an insured State nonmember bank, be and hereby is terminated as of August 13, 1998.
   IT IS FURTHER ORDERED, that the separate insurance of all deposits assumed by Guaranty shall terminate on February 7, 1999, or in the case of any time deposit, the earliest maturity date after February 7, 1999, as provided in section 8(q) of the Act, 12 U.S.C. §1818(q).
   Pursuant to delegated authority.
   Dated at Washington, D.C., this 30th day of December, 1998.
